How Much Does It Cost to Own a Doc Popcorn's Franchise?
Doc Popcorn — Active member of the retail food industry since 2009
Owning a Doc Popcorn retail food franchise can be a business, but it does have some initial financial requirements. To open a single nuts/popcorn location, the company requires that potential franchisees have liquid assets of at least $100,000.

Doc Popcorn is the largest franchised retailer of popcorn on the planet and was named a top new franchise by Entrepreneur two years in a row! The kernel to our success is we empower franchise owners to handcraft a wide-variety of remarkable fresh-popped specialty flavors of popcorn with a system that is extremely simple, efficient and affordable.
